New Adakwai
New Adakwai is a village in Adansi North District, Ashanti Region. New Adakwai is situated nearby to the village Adokwae, as well as near Edwenase.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Fomena
Town
Fomena is a small town and the capital of the Adansi North District. The town is the seat of the paramount chief of the Adansi traditional council. The town is known as the place where the Fomena treaty was signed. Fomena is situated 10 km south of New Adakwai.
